Sage smudge stick is a special bundle of dried sage leaves, often used in spiritual practices. People have used sage for hundreds of years to clean the energy in a room or around a person. The smoke from burning sage is believed to carry away bad energy and bring peace and clarity. Many cultures, especially Native American traditions, see sage as a sacred plant. Today, sage smudge sticks are still popular for their spiritual power and simple use.

Sage Smudge Stick in Ancient and Modern Traditions
Sage smudge sticks have deep roots in Native American spiritual practices. For many tribes, sage is one of the “sacred plants” used in ceremonies to pray, purify, and connect with Spirit. Elders often burn sage during talking circles or healing events. They see it as a gift from the Earth that helps bring people closer to their higher self.
Today, sage smudge sticks are also used by people from many walks of life. Even though the practice comes from Indigenous wisdom, others have learned to use it with respect and care.
In modern times, sage smudging is found in yoga spaces, healing rooms, and quiet homes. Some people mix it with other spiritual tools like meditation or energy healing. It is still a symbol of peace, purity, and spiritual connection.
If you use sage smudge sticks, it is good to honor its roots and treat it with respect. Always use it mindfully and never as a trend or decoration. The plant itself, and the tradition behind it, deserve kindness.
Using Sage Smudge Stick to Cleanse Your Aura
Your aura is the invisible energy field around your body. Sometimes, our aura picks up energy from other people, places, or even our own thoughts. This can make us feel tired, worried, or not quite ourselves.
Smudging with sage can help clear your aura. The smoke passes around your body and helps remove any stuck or low energy. It is a simple and gentle way to return to your true energy.
To smudge your aura, you can follow these simple steps:
- Light the end of the sage smudge stick until it starts to smoke.
- Hold the stick safely away from your body.
- Slowly move the smoke around your head, arms, heart, back, and legs.
- Imagine the smoke washing your energy clean.
- Say a soft prayer or affirmation if you like.
- When finished, press the smudge stick into a fireproof bowl or sand to put it out.
This type of smudging is often done before meditation or bedtime. It can make you feel lighter and more peaceful.

Respectful Use of Sage Smudge Stick
It’s important to use sage smudge sticks with respect. This means understanding where it comes from and how it has been used by Native American people for many years. Some tribes still use sage in sacred ceremonies today.
If you are not part of these traditions, you can still use sage in your own way. But it’s kind to learn about the history and not treat sage as just a “trend.” Buy your sage from ethical sellers who respect the Earth and the cultures who shared this wisdom.
